On Wed, Aug 30, 2017 at 10:13:43AM -0700, Darrick J. Wong wrote:


 > > I reverted the debug patches mentioned above, and ran trinity for a while again,
 > > and got this which smells really suspiciously related
 > > 
 > > WARNING: CPU: 1 PID: 10380 at fs/iomap.c:993 iomap_dio_rw+0x825/0x840
 > > RAX: 00000000fffffff0 RBX: ffff88046a64d0e8 RCX: 0000000000000000
 > > 
 > > 
 > > 
 > > That's this..
 > > 
 > >  987         ret = filemap_write_and_wait_range(mapping, start, end);
 > >  988         if (ret)
 > >  989                 goto out_free_dio;
 > >  990 
 > >  991         ret = invalidate_inode_pages2_range(mapping,
 > >  992                         start >> PAGE_SHIFT, end >> PAGE_SHIFT);
 > >  993         WARN_ON_ONCE(ret);
 > > 
 > > 
 > > Plot thickens..
 > 
 > Hm, that's the WARN_ON that comes from a failed pagecache invalidation
 > prior to a dio operation, which implies that something's mixing buffered
 > and dio?

Plausible. Judging by RAX, we got -EBUSY

 > Given that it's syzkaller it wouldn't surprise me to hear that it's
 > doing that... :)

s/syzkaller/trinity/, but yes.
